Hemphill RV Parks: 2 Campgrounds in Texas Piney Woods

Hemphill, Texas, is the Sabine County seat and home to 2 RV parks, serving as a primary gateway for anglers and boaters accessing the 185,000-acre Toledo Bend Reservoir. This East Texas destination provides direct routes to over 1,200 miles of shoreline and major bass fishing tournaments.

How many RV parks are in Hemphill?

Hemphill contains 2 distinct campgrounds, both positioned within 5 miles of Toledo Bend Reservoir's public boat ramps. These two properties offer a combined total of approximately 150 sites for RVs and travel trailers.

What types of RV sites are available?

Options include full-hookup concrete pads and shaded, back-in gravel spots. Lowe's Creek Park features 50-amp service and sites measuring 35 x 80 feet, while Paradise Point RV Marina offers waterfront pull-through slots with dedicated boat slips.

What are the average nightly rates?

Standard rates range from $40 to $65 per night for full-hookup sites. Premium waterfront locations or sites with covered boat docks command prices between $75 and $95 nightly, especially during the spring bass fishing season from March through May.

Which amenities are most common?

Both campgrounds prioritize lake access and fishing infrastructure. Standard amenities include:

  • Private boat ramps and fish cleaning stations
  • Propane filling stations and basic camp stores
  • Laundry facilities and restrooms with showers
  • Pet-friendly policies with designated dog walk areas

When is the best time to visit for fishing?

The prime fishing window runs from early March to late June, aligning with major bass spawns and tournaments. Toledo Bend hosts over 20 professionally sanctioned bass competitions annually, drawing participants from across Texas and Louisiana.

How does Hemphill compare to other East Texas RV destinations?

Hemphill provides a quieter, reservoir-focused alternative to the busier recreational corridors near Jasper, TX or the casino resorts in Kinder, LA. Its two parks specialize in angler services rather than the general tourist amenities found in larger destinations.
